Eligibility Criteria for Ph.D. in Biochemistry at Mysore University
- A Master’s degree (M.Sc. or equivalent) in Biochemistry, Chemistry, Molecular Biology, or a closely related discipline with a minimum of 55% aggregate (or CGPA equivalent).
- Candidates with a Bachelor’s degree (B.Sc.) in Biochemistry or related subjects are eligible if they have secured at least 60% aggregate and have published a research paper in a peer‑reviewed journal.
- Candidates must have qualified the university‑level Entrance Exam for Ph.D. in Biochemistry or possess a valid national level qualification (e.g., CSIR‑UGC NET, GATE, JEST).
- Age limit: No upper age restriction, but candidates must be physically and mentally fit to undertake research activities.
Entrance Exam for Ph.D. in Biochemistry at Mysore University
The entrance assessment evaluates both theoretical knowledge and research aptitude:
- Written Test – 100 marks covering General Biochemistry, Molecular Biology, Enzymology, and Analytical Techniques.
- Interview & Research Proposal Presentation – Candidates discuss their previous research experiences and propose a prospective thesis topic.
- Merit Consideration – Candidates who have cleared national eligibility exams (NET, GATE) may be exempted from the written test.

Admission Process for Ph.D. in Biochemistry at Mysore University
- Online application through the university portal (provide all academic certificates, mark sheets, and ID proof).
- Upload the research proposal (max 1500 words) and the PhD Admission Assistance document for guidance.
- Pay the non‑refundable application fee of INR 2,000.
- Shortlisted candidates are called for the written test and interview.
- Final selection is based on merit, interview performance, and research proposal relevance.
- Admission confirmation is sent via email, followed by enrollment and fee payment.

Mysore University Ph.D. Syllabus for Biochemistry
The curriculum blends core modules with extensive research work:
- Core Courses (Year 1)
- Advanced Biochemistry
- Techniques in Molecular Biology
- Statistical Methods for Biological Data
- Research Ethics & Scientific Writing
- Electives (Year 1‑2)
- Protein Crystallography
- Metabolomics
- Computational Modeling
- Clinical Biochemistry
- Research Thesis (Year 2‑3)
- Original experimental work under a faculty supervisor.
- Regular progress reports and seminars.
- Submission of a dissertation (≈150 pages) followed by a viva‑voce.

- 1. What is the minimum duration to complete the Ph.D.?
- The program is structured for three years of full‑time study, but extensions up to two additional years may be granted for valid research delays.
- 2. Can I pursue the Ph.D. part‑time while working?
- Yes, Mysore University offers a part‑time option for working professionals, extending the duration to five years, subject to approval by the department head.
- 3. Is there a provision for foreign students?
- International candidates with an equivalent Master’s degree and qualifying test scores are welcome. They must obtain a student visa and meet English proficiency requirements.
- 4. How many research publications are required before submission?
- While there is no strict quota, having at least one peer‑reviewed article or conference paper markedly improves the admission prospects.
